    There was once a man named John Mc Guinney living near Breecy. One night he was returning home with his horse and cart, and suddenly two lighted candles appeared on the horse’s ears. He got off to see what was wrong but when he was down all had disappeared.
    Another time when he was out with his horse and cart he saw a black pig run in and out between the wheels of the cart. He again got off but then no sign of the pig could he see.
    At the foot of Breecy Mountain there is a rock and it is told that long ago Fionn Mc Cool threw this stone from the top of Breecy. The marks still on the rock are said to be the tracks of his fingers.
